§ 23.1-2907.1 — Policy for award of academic credit for apprenticeship credentials

The State Board shall require each comprehensive community college to develop policies and procedures for the award of academic credit to any student enrolled in a comprehensive community college who has successfully completed a state-approved registered apprenticeship credential in a field that is aligned with a credit-bearing program of study at the comprehensive community college in which the student is enrolled. Such policies shall ensure that academic credit is awarded only to students who have achieved the same outcomes and with the same academic rigor as in the equivalent courses offered by the institution.
